What is Erasmus +?

Erasmus+ is the EU’s programme to support education, training, youth and sport in Europe and in partner countries. For the 2021-2027 period, it has a budget of an estimated €26.2 billion. This is almost double the funding of the previous programme for the 2014-2020 period.

With more than 35 years of history, Erasmus+ promotes academic cooperation projects between European and Latin American universities in order to improve the quality of higher education and foster intercultural dialogue and understanding through mobility grants and training and exchange programs at all levels. E+ projects are funded by the European Commission through its Executive Agency for Education, Audiovisual and Culture (EACEA) based in Brussels.

PUCP has participated in several similar projects and is constantly seeking new opportunities for participation. Currently, PUCP participates in the International Credit Mobility (ICM) modality, which directly benefits students, faculty and staff; and in Capacity Building in Higher Education (CBHE) Programs, which comprise institutional activities led by academic or administrative units. Erasmus+ mobilities are compensated.
